Math Problem Statement

Which situation below represents the graph? (The number line starts at -7, moves to 6, and then back to -3.)

Solution

To solve this problem, we will compare the provided number line graph with each mathematical expression.

The number line shows a movement starting at 7-7, moving right to 66 (represented by the arrow ending at 66) and then moving left back to 3-3.

Now, let's break down each of the options:

Option a) 7+139-7 + 13 - 9

  1. Start at 7-7.
  2. Add 1313: 7+13=6-7 + 13 = 6 So you move from 7-7 to 66.
  3. Subtract 99: 69=36 - 9 = -3 So you move back from 66 to 3-3.

This matches the graph perfectly, which shows a movement from 7-7 to 66, then back to 3-3.

Option b) 713+9-7 - 13 + 9

  1. Start at 7-7.
  2. Subtract 1313: 713=20-7 - 13 = -20 This does not match the graph.

Option c) 7139-7 - 13 - 9

  1. Start at 7-7.
  2. Subtract 1313: 713=20-7 - 13 = -20 Again, this does not match the graph.

Conclusion:

The correct option is a) 7+139-7 + 13 - 9, as it matches the movements shown on the number line.
